Abstract :
A product line approach is a disciplined methodology for strategic reuse of source code, requirement specifications, software architectures, design models, components, test cases, and the processes for using the aforementioned artifacts. Software process simulation modeling is a valuable tool for enabling decision making for a wide variety of purposes, ranging from adoption and strategic management to process improvement and planning. In this paper, discrete event simulation is used to provide a framework for the simulation of software product line engineering. We have created an environment that facilitates strategic management and long-term forecasting with respect to software product line development and evolution.
